NEWS

在软件开发中,如何平衡快速发布和保证质量之间的关系?

2024.02.26火猫网络阅读量: 15200

在软件开发中,平衡快速发布和保证质量之间的关系确实是一个挑战,但并非无法实现。关键在于建立一个高效的开发流程,并注重以下几个方面:

首先,明确需求并设定合理的目标。在开始开发之前,与团队成员充分沟通,确保每个人都清楚了解项目的需求和目标。这有助于避免在开发过程中出现不必要的返工和修改,从而节省时间并保持质量。

其次,采用敏捷开发方法。敏捷开发方法强调快速迭代和持续改进,通过短周期的冲刺来逐步完成软件开发。这种方法允许团队在开发过程中及时发现问题并进行调整,从而实现快速发布的同时保证质量。

再者,自动化测试是关键。通过编写自动化测试用例,可以在每次代码更改后快速运行测试,确保软件的功能和性能没有受到影响。这不仅可以提高测试效率,还可以避免在发布后出现严重的质量问题。

此外,持续集成和持续部署(CI/CD)也是实现平衡的重要手段。通过自动化构建、测试和部署流程,可以加快软件发布的速度,同时确保每个版本都经过了充分的验证和测试。

最后,团队之间的紧密协作和沟通也至关重要。鼓励团队成员分享经验、互相学习和提供支持,可以提高整个团队的开发效率和问题解决能力。

总之,平衡软件开发中的快速发布和保证质量需要综合考虑多个方面。通过明确需求、采用敏捷方法、自动化测试、持续集成和部署以及团队协作等手段,可以实现这一目标。

希望这些建议能对您有所帮助!如果您觉得有用,请点赞支持一下哦!同时,欢迎关注我们“火猫网络”,我们主营网站开发和小程序开发,为您提供更专业的软件开发服务。

联系我们